Our final contribution to this collaboration is now online. We obtained electrophysiological recordings of DRG/TG neurons and Fos+ neurons of spinal dorsal horn & vlPAG in 2 models of neuropathic pain to study the actions of a humanized P2X4R scFv #PainResearch www.sciencedirect.com/science/arti...
Physiological actions of a humanized P2X4 scFv on peripheral and central neurons in male mice with neuropathic pain
Neuropathic pain remains a challenging clinical condition due to its resistance to conventional analgesics. The purinergic P2X4 receptor (P2X4R), an A…

I’m proud to share that our first paper from the lab has just been published in Nature Communications: www.nature.com/articles/s41...
This work uncovers a mechanism by which autoantibodies targeting CRMP5 contribute to neuropathic pain in paraneoplastic syndromes.
#PainResearch
Anti-CV2/CRMP5 autoantibodies as drivers of sensory neuron excitability and pain in rats - Nature Communications
Lung and thymoma cancer patients often suffer from autoimmunity and related painful neuropathies. Here the authors show that patient-derived anti-CRMP5 autoantibody binds to rat dorsal root ganglia to...
